BUSSEY, Justice:

This is an appeal from a jury verdict in the amount of $36,500.00, in a condemnation proceeding wherein respondent was acquiring a power line right of way across the property of appellant. The right of way was 150 feet in width and included within the condemnation was the right to cut all danger trees beyond the right of way tall enough to come in contact with respondent's power lines...
